$111K table game jackpot hits on Strip

Updated June 27, 2022 - 11:22 am

Bally’s still has some magic left.

Although the Strip casino will soon be rebranded as Horseshoe Las Vegas, one player will retain positive memories of the Bally’s name — in addition to a very good chunk of change.

A player won $111,962 playing Face Up Pai Gow Poker at Bally’s on Saturday, according to a Caesars Entertainment news release.

Five aces triggered the jackpot. In pai gow, the joker can be used as an ace or to complete a flush or straight.
